Kinds Of Optical Fibre Tests
Different testing methods are used to make certain the performance and integrity of optical fibres within communication networks. These tests can be generally classified into two major kinds: installment tests and upkeep tests.
Setup examinations are performed immediately after the installation of optical fibre cords to confirm their efficiency and integrity - robotic vision. One of the most usual installment tests include Optical Time-Domain Reflectometry (OTDR) examinations, which assess the top quality of the fiber by recognizing mistakes or breaks, and end-to-end loss examinations, which determine the total optical loss from one end of the fiber to the various other
Maintenance tests, on the various other hand, are done occasionally to make sure continuous performance and identify potential issues over time. These include visual inspection, which look for physical damages or improper setups, and connection examinations, which confirm that the signal can travel through the fiber without disruption.
Additionally, advanced examinations such as Polarization Mode Diffusion (PMD) and Chromatic Diffusion (CD) tests can be performed to review the fiber's efficiency under various problems. By using these varied testing techniques, specialists can maintain high criteria of quality and reliability in optical fibre networks.

Typical Issues Recognized
Recognizing typical concerns in optical fibre networks is important for preserving optimum efficiency and reliability. Different aspects can add to disturbances, including physical damages, inadequate setup practices, and ecological influences.
Physical damage, such as bends, breaks, or abrasions, can considerably weaken signal top quality. Incorrect installation methods, including excessive stress or poor safeguarding of cords, may cause raised depletion and loss of connectivity. Additionally, ecological variables such as temperature changes, dampness ingress, and rodent interference can compromise the stability of the fibre.
Port issues also often develop, with incorrect placement or contamination leading to enhanced insertion loss. Splicing mistakes can present substantial signal deterioration if not performed with accuracy.
One more common worry is the aging of infrastructure, where older cables might display enhanced attenuation with time, requiring prompt screening and substitute. Inadequate screening during installation can result in undetected mistakes that may materialize as performance concerns later on.
